Is Shingletown, CA Safe?

The C grade means the rate of theft is slightly higher than the average US city. Shingletown is in the 41st percentile for safety, meaning 59% of cities are safer and 41% of cities are more dangerous. This analysis applies to Shingletown's proper boundaries only. See the table on nearby places below for nearby cities.

The rate of theft in Shingletown is 10.38 per 1,000 residents during a standard year. People who live in Shingletown generally consider the southwest part of the city to be the safest.

Your chance of being a victim of theft in Shingletown may be as high as 1 in 63 in the northwest neighborhoods, or as low as 1 in 146 in the southwest part of the city. See the section on interpreting the theft map, however, because comparing rates for theft or any other crime is not as intuitive as it may seem.

By a simple count ignoring population, more crimes occur in the northeast parts of Shingletown, CA: about 11 per year. The southeast part of Shingletown has fewer cases of theft with only 0 in a typical year.

Interpreting the Theft Maps

When looking at the theft map for Shingletown, remember that the rate of theft per resident may appear inflated when people visit the area during the day, but do not live there. For example, there are more retail establishments in the southwest part of the city. Many crimes are committed in retail areas in blocks where few people live. Red areas on the theft rate map do not always indicate danger for Shingletown residents who live there.

More issues arise with places like airports, parks, and schools. Major airports, of which Shingletown has 0, always look like high-crime locations due to the large number of people and the low population nearby. Parks and designated recreational areas, of which Shingletown has 1, have the same problem. Of Shingletown’s 4,007 residents, few live near recreational areas. Because many people visit, crime rates may appear higher even for safe parks. Ultimately crime happens where people are, whether they live there or not. Before writing off an area as unsafe, look at both the crime rate and total crime maps, then consider nearby destinations that people may be visiting.
